Download selenium-java-2.21.0.jar file

Introduction

You can download selenium-java-2.21.0.jar in this page.

License

The Apache Software License, Version 2.0

Type List

selenium-java-2.21.0.jar file has the following types.

META-INF/MANIFEST.MF
META-INF/maven/org.seleniumhq.selenium/selenium-java/pom.properties
META-INF/maven/org.seleniumhq.selenium/selenium-java/pom.xml
com.thoughtworks.selenium.DefaultRemoteCommand.class
com.thoughtworks.selenium.DefaultSelenium.class
com.thoughtworks.selenium.HttpCommandProcessor.class
com.thoughtworks.selenium.RemoteCommand.class
com.thoughtworks.selenium.ScreenshotListener.class
com.thoughtworks.selenium.SeleneseTestBase.class
com.thoughtworks.selenium.SeleneseTestCase.class
com.thoughtworks.selenium.SeleneseTestNgHelper.class
com.thoughtworks.selenium.Wait.class
com.thoughtworks.selenium.condition.Condition.class
com.thoughtworks.selenium.condition.ConditionRunner.class
com.thoughtworks.selenium.condition.DefaultConditionRunner.class
com.thoughtworks.selenium.condition.JUnit4AndTestNgConditionRunner.class
com.thoughtworks.selenium.condition.JUnitConditionRunner.class
com.thoughtworks.selenium.condition.Not.class
com.thoughtworks.selenium.condition.Presence.class
com.thoughtworks.selenium.condition.Text.class
org.openqa.selenium.SeleneseCommandExecutor.class
org.openqa.selenium.WebDriverBackedSelenium.class
org.openqa.selenium.WebDriverCommandProcessor.class
org.openqa.selenium.internal.selenesedriver.AbstractElementFinder.class
org.openqa.selenium.internal.selenesedriver.ClearElement.class
org.openqa.selenium.internal.selenesedriver.ClickElement.class
org.openqa.selenium.internal.selenesedriver.Close.class
org.openqa.selenium.internal.selenesedriver.ElementFunction.class
org.openqa.selenium.internal.selenesedriver.ExecuteAsyncScript.class
org.openqa.selenium.internal.selenesedriver.ExecuteScript.class
org.openqa.selenium.internal.selenesedriver.FindElement.class
org.openqa.selenium.internal.selenesedriver.FindElements.class
org.openqa.selenium.internal.selenesedriver.GetActiveElement.class
org.openqa.selenium.internal.selenesedriver.GetCurrentUrl.class
org.openqa.selenium.internal.selenesedriver.GetElementAttribute.class
org.openqa.selenium.internal.selenesedriver.GetElementText.class
org.openqa.selenium.internal.selenesedriver.GetElementValue.class
org.openqa.selenium.internal.selenesedriver.GetPageSource.class
org.openqa.selenium.internal.selenesedriver.GetSize.class
org.openqa.selenium.internal.selenesedriver.GetTagName.class
org.openqa.selenium.internal.selenesedriver.GetTitle.class
org.openqa.selenium.internal.selenesedriver.GetUrl.class
org.openqa.selenium.internal.selenesedriver.IsElementDisplayed.class
org.openqa.selenium.internal.selenesedriver.IsElementEnabled.class
org.openqa.selenium.internal.selenesedriver.IsElementSelected.class
org.openqa.selenium.internal.selenesedriver.NewSession.class
org.openqa.selenium.internal.selenesedriver.QuitSelenium.class
org.openqa.selenium.internal.selenesedriver.ScriptExecutor.class
org.openqa.selenium.internal.selenesedriver.SeleneseFunction.class
org.openqa.selenium.internal.selenesedriver.SendKeys.class
org.openqa.selenium.internal.selenesedriver.SubmitElement.class
org.openqa.selenium.internal.selenesedriver.SwitchToFrame.class
org.openqa.selenium.internal.selenesedriver.TakeScreenshot.class
org.openqa.selenium.internal.seleniumemulation.AddLocationStrategy.class
org.openqa.selenium.internal.seleniumemulation.AddSelection.class
org.openqa.selenium.internal.seleniumemulation.AlertOverride.class
org.openqa.selenium.internal.seleniumemulation.AllowNativeXPath.class
org.openqa.selenium.internal.seleniumemulation.AltKeyDown.class
org.openqa.selenium.internal.seleniumemulation.AltKeyUp.class
org.openqa.selenium.internal.seleniumemulation.AssignId.class
org.openqa.selenium.internal.seleniumemulation.AttachFile.class
org.openqa.selenium.internal.seleniumemulation.CaptureScreenshotToString.class
org.openqa.selenium.internal.seleniumemulation.Check.class
org.openqa.selenium.internal.seleniumemulation.Click.class
org.openqa.selenium.internal.seleniumemulation.ClickAt.class
org.openqa.selenium.internal.seleniumemulation.Close.class
org.openqa.selenium.internal.seleniumemulation.CompoundMutator.class
org.openqa.selenium.internal.seleniumemulation.ControlKeyDown.class
org.openqa.selenium.internal.seleniumemulation.ControlKeyUp.class
org.openqa.selenium.internal.seleniumemulation.CreateCookie.class
org.openqa.selenium.internal.seleniumemulation.DeleteAllVisibleCookies.class
org.openqa.selenium.internal.seleniumemulation.DeleteCookie.class
org.openqa.selenium.internal.seleniumemulation.DoubleClick.class
org.openqa.selenium.internal.seleniumemulation.DragAndDrop.class
org.openqa.selenium.internal.seleniumemulation.ElementFinder.class
org.openqa.selenium.internal.seleniumemulation.FindFirstSelectedOptionProperty.class
org.openqa.selenium.internal.seleniumemulation.FindSelectedOptionProperties.class
org.openqa.selenium.internal.seleniumemulation.FireEvent.class
org.openqa.selenium.internal.seleniumemulation.FireNamedEvent.class
org.openqa.selenium.internal.seleniumemulation.FunctionDeclaration.class
org.openqa.selenium.internal.seleniumemulation.GetAlert.class
org.openqa.selenium.internal.seleniumemulation.GetAllButtons.class
org.openqa.selenium.internal.seleniumemulation.GetAllFields.class
org.openqa.selenium.internal.seleniumemulation.GetAllLinks.class
org.openqa.selenium.internal.seleniumemulation.GetAllWindowTitles.class
org.openqa.selenium.internal.seleniumemulation.GetAttribute.class
org.openqa.selenium.internal.seleniumemulation.GetAttributeFromAllWindows.class
org.openqa.selenium.internal.seleniumemulation.GetBodyText.class
org.openqa.selenium.internal.seleniumemulation.GetConfirmation.class
org.openqa.selenium.internal.seleniumemulation.GetCookie.class
org.openqa.selenium.internal.seleniumemulation.GetCookieByName.class
org.openqa.selenium.internal.seleniumemulation.GetCssCount.class
org.openqa.selenium.internal.seleniumemulation.GetElementHeight.class
org.openqa.selenium.internal.seleniumemulation.GetElementIndex.class
org.openqa.selenium.internal.seleniumemulation.GetElementPositionLeft.class
org.openqa.selenium.internal.seleniumemulation.GetElementPositionTop.class
org.openqa.selenium.internal.seleniumemulation.GetElementWidth.class
org.openqa.selenium.internal.seleniumemulation.GetEval.class
org.openqa.selenium.internal.seleniumemulation.GetExpression.class
org.openqa.selenium.internal.seleniumemulation.GetHtmlSource.class
org.openqa.selenium.internal.seleniumemulation.GetLocation.class
org.openqa.selenium.internal.seleniumemulation.GetSelectOptions.class
org.openqa.selenium.internal.seleniumemulation.GetTable.class
org.openqa.selenium.internal.seleniumemulation.GetText.class
org.openqa.selenium.internal.seleniumemulation.GetTitle.class
org.openqa.selenium.internal.seleniumemulation.GetValue.class
org.openqa.selenium.internal.seleniumemulation.GetXpathCount.class
org.openqa.selenium.internal.seleniumemulation.GoBack.class
org.openqa.selenium.internal.seleniumemulation.Highlight.class
org.openqa.selenium.internal.seleniumemulation.IsAlertPresent.class
org.openqa.selenium.internal.seleniumemulation.IsChecked.class
org.openqa.selenium.internal.seleniumemulation.IsConfirmationPresent.class
org.openqa.selenium.internal.seleniumemulation.IsCookiePresent.class
org.openqa.selenium.internal.seleniumemulation.IsEditable.class
org.openqa.selenium.internal.seleniumemulation.IsElementPresent.class
org.openqa.selenium.internal.seleniumemulation.IsOrdered.class
org.openqa.selenium.internal.seleniumemulation.IsSomethingSelected.class
org.openqa.selenium.internal.seleniumemulation.IsTextPresent.class
org.openqa.selenium.internal.seleniumemulation.IsVisible.class
org.openqa.selenium.internal.seleniumemulation.JavascriptLibrary.class
org.openqa.selenium.internal.seleniumemulation.KeyEvent.class
org.openqa.selenium.internal.seleniumemulation.KeyState.class
org.openqa.selenium.internal.seleniumemulation.MetaKeyDown.class
org.openqa.selenium.internal.seleniumemulation.MetaKeyUp.class
org.openqa.selenium.internal.seleniumemulation.MethodDeclaration.class
org.openqa.selenium.internal.seleniumemulation.MouseEvent.class
org.openqa.selenium.internal.seleniumemulation.MouseEventAt.class
org.openqa.selenium.internal.seleniumemulation.NoOp.class
org.openqa.selenium.internal.seleniumemulation.Open.class
org.openqa.selenium.internal.seleniumemulation.OpenWindow.class
org.openqa.selenium.internal.seleniumemulation.Refresh.class
org.openqa.selenium.internal.seleniumemulation.RemoveAllSelections.class
org.openqa.selenium.internal.seleniumemulation.RemoveSelection.class
org.openqa.selenium.internal.seleniumemulation.RunScript.class
org.openqa.selenium.internal.seleniumemulation.ScriptMutator.class
org.openqa.selenium.internal.seleniumemulation.SelectFrame.class
org.openqa.selenium.internal.seleniumemulation.SelectOption.class
org.openqa.selenium.internal.seleniumemulation.SelectWindow.class
org.openqa.selenium.internal.seleniumemulation.SeleneseCommand.class
org.openqa.selenium.internal.seleniumemulation.SeleniumMutator.class
org.openqa.selenium.internal.seleniumemulation.SeleniumSelect.class
org.openqa.selenium.internal.seleniumemulation.SetNextConfirmationState.class
org.openqa.selenium.internal.seleniumemulation.SetTimeout.class
org.openqa.selenium.internal.seleniumemulation.ShiftKeyDown.class
org.openqa.selenium.internal.seleniumemulation.ShiftKeyUp.class
org.openqa.selenium.internal.seleniumemulation.Submit.class
org.openqa.selenium.internal.seleniumemulation.Timer.class
org.openqa.selenium.internal.seleniumemulation.Type.class
org.openqa.selenium.internal.seleniumemulation.TypeKeys.class
org.openqa.selenium.internal.seleniumemulation.Uncheck.class
org.openqa.selenium.internal.seleniumemulation.UseXPathLibrary.class
org.openqa.selenium.internal.seleniumemulation.VariableDeclaration.class
org.openqa.selenium.internal.seleniumemulation.WaitForCondition.class
org.openqa.selenium.internal.seleniumemulation.WaitForPageToLoad.class
org.openqa.selenium.internal.seleniumemulation.WaitForPopup.class
org.openqa.selenium.internal.seleniumemulation.WindowFocus.class
org.openqa.selenium.internal.seleniumemulation.WindowMaximize.class
org.openqa.selenium.internal.seleniumemulation.Windows.class
org/openqa/selenium/internal/seleniumemulation/findElement.js
org/openqa/selenium/internal/seleniumemulation/findOption.js
org/openqa/selenium/internal/seleniumemulation/fireEvent.js
org/openqa/selenium/internal/seleniumemulation/fireEventAt.js
org/openqa/selenium/internal/seleniumemulation/getAttribute.js
org/openqa/selenium/internal/seleniumemulation/getText.js
org/openqa/selenium/internal/seleniumemulation/htmlutils.js
org/openqa/selenium/internal/seleniumemulation/injectableSelenium.js
org/openqa/selenium/internal/seleniumemulation/isElementPresent.js
org/openqa/selenium/internal/seleniumemulation/isSomethingSelected.js
org/openqa/selenium/internal/seleniumemulation/isTextPresent.js
org/openqa/selenium/internal/seleniumemulation/isVisible.js
org/openqa/selenium/internal/seleniumemulation/linkLocator.js
org/openqa/selenium/internal/seleniumemulation/sizzle.js
org/openqa/selenium/internal/seleniumemulation/type.js

Pom

selenium-java-2.21.0.pom file content.

<?xml version="1.0" encoding="Windows-1252"?>
<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/maven-v4_0_0.xsd">

    <modelVersion>4.0.0</modelVersion>

    <parent>
        <groupId>org.seleniumhq.selenium</groupId>
        <artifactId>selenium-parent</artifactId>
        <version>2.21.0</version>
    </parent>
    <artifactId>selenium-java</artifactId>
    <name>selenium-java</name>

    <dependencies>
        <dependency>
            <groupId>org.seleniumhq.selenium</groupId>
            <artifactId>selenium-android-driver</artifactId>
            <version>${project.version}</version>
        </dependency>
        <dependency>
            <groupId>org.seleniumhq.selenium</groupId>
            <artifactId>selenium-chrome-driver</artifactId>
            <version>${project.version}</version>
        </dependency>
        <dependency>
            <groupId>org.seleniumhq.selenium</groupId>
            <artifactId>selenium-htmlunit-driver</artifactId>
            <version>${project.version}</version>
        </dependency>
        <dependency>
            <groupId>org.seleniumhq.selenium</groupId>
            <artifactId>selenium-firefox-driver</artifactId>
            <version>${project.version}</version>
        </dependency>
        <dependency>
            <groupId>org.seleniumhq.selenium</groupId>
            <artifactId>selenium-ie-driver</artifactId>
            <version>${project.version}</version>
        </dependency>
        <dependency>
            <groupId>org.seleniumhq.selenium</groupId>
            <artifactId>selenium-iphone-driver</artifactId>
            <version>${project.version}</version>
        </dependency>
        <dependency>
            <groupId>org.seleniumhq.selenium</groupId>
            <artifactId>selenium-safari-driver</artifactId>
            <version>${project.version}</version>
        </dependency>
        <dependency>
            <groupId>org.seleniumhq.selenium</groupId>
            <artifactId>selenium-support</artifactId>
            <version>${project.version}</version>
        </dependency>
        <dependency>
            <groupId>org.webbitserver</groupId>
            <artifactId>webbit</artifactId>
        </dependency>
        <!-- We need JUnit for SeleneseTestCase ... -->
        <dependency>
            <groupId>junit</groupId>
            <artifactId>junit</artifactId>
            <optional>true</optional>
        </dependency>
        <!-- We need TestNG for SeleneseTestNgHelper ... -->
        <dependency>
            <groupId>org.testng</groupId>
            <artifactId>testng</artifactId>
            <optional>true</optional>
        </dependency>
    </dependencies>

    <build>
        <plugins>
            <!-- See http://maven.apache.org/plugins/maven-antrun-plugin -->
            <plugin>
                <artifactId>maven-antrun-plugin</artifactId>
                <executions>
                    <execution>
                        <id>copy_java_files</id>
                        <phase>generate-sources</phase>
                        <configuration>
                            <tasks>
                                <delete dir="src/main/java" />
                                <copy todir="src/main/java" includeEmptyDirs="false">
                                    <fileset dir="../../java/client/src">
                                        <include name="**/*.java" />
                                        <not>
                                            <or>
                                                <present targetdir="../android-driver/src/main/java" />
                                                <present targetdir="../api/src/main/java" />
                                                <present targetdir="../chrome-driver/src/main/java" />
                                                <present targetdir="../firefox-driver/src/main/java" />
                                                <present targetdir="../htmlunit-driver/src/main/java" />
                                                <present targetdir="../ie-driver/src/main/java" />
                                                <present targetdir="../iphone-driver/src/main/java" />
                                                <present targetdir="../remote-driver/src/main/java" />
                                                <present targetdir="../safari-driver/src/main/java" />
                                                <present targetdir="../support/src/main/java" />
                                            </or>
                                        </not>
                                    </fileset>
                                </copy>
                            </tasks>
                        </configuration>
                        <goals>
                            <goal>run</goal>
                        </goals>
                    </execution>
                    <execution>
                        <id>copy_resource_files</id>
                        <phase>generate-resources</phase>
                        <configuration>
                            <tasks>
                                <!-- Extract *.js files from client-combined-nodeps.jar to target/classes ... -->
                                <unjar src="../../build/java/client/src/org/openqa/selenium/client-combined-nodeps.jar" dest="target/classes">
                                    <patternset>
                                        <include name="scripts/selenium/*.js" />
                                        <include name="**/seleniumemulation/*.js" />
                                        <include name="org/openqa/selenium/internal/build.properties" />
                                    </patternset>
                                </unjar>
                            </tasks>
                        </configuration>
                        <goals>
                            <goal>run</goal>
                        </goals>
                    </execution>
                </executions>
            </plugin>
            <plugin>
                <artifactId>maven-surefire-plugin</artifactId>
                <configuration>
                    <skip>true</skip>
                    <failIfNoTests>false</failIfNoTests>
                </configuration>
            </plugin>
        </plugins>
    </build>

</project>

POM Entry

<dependency>
   <groupId>org.seleniumhq.selenium</groupId>
   <artifactId>selenium-java</artifactId>
   <version>2.21.0</version>
</dependency>

Download

If you think the following selenium-java-2.21.0.jar downloaded from Maven central repository is inappropriate, such as containing malicious code/tools or violating the copyright, please email , thanks.



Download selenium-java-2.21.0.jar file




PreviousNext

Related